Job Description
Innovasol Enterprise is seeking an experienced and highly organized Lead Travel Agent to serve as the primary point of contact for all travel bookings across our brands, including Rooted Journeys and Mom Trotter. This role is responsible for managing the full booking lifecycle from inquiry to confirmation, ensuring every client receives professional, timely, and high-quality service. The successful candidate will oversee group trips, youth camps, safaris, cruises, and custom travel experiences, ensuring accuracy in reservations, payments, documentation, and communication.
Our travel brands primarily serve a U.S.-based audience, and we are expanding into the Nigerian and broader African markets. The ideal candidate must understand American client service standards, communication expectations, responsiveness, and booking workflows, while also being able to adapt to emerging local markets. Availability to work weekdays and weekends is key due to client intake and trip schedules.

Key Responsibilities
- Serve as the primary point of contact for all travel inquiries and bookings.
- Manage the full client journey from inquiry, consultation, proposal, confirmation, and payment tracking.
- Coordinate group travel bookings including flights, accommodations, transfers, excursions, and insurance.
- Ensure all bookings are accurate, documented, and properly tracked.
- Maintain organized client files, contracts, invoices, and payment records.
- Follow up consistently with leads and confirmed clients.
- Oversee bookings for group trips, youth camps, safaris, cruises, and hosted travel experiences.
- Coordinate directly with suppliers, hotels, tour operators, cruise lines, and travel partners.
- Ensure all trip components are secured and confirmed on time.
- Monitor booking deadlines, payment schedules, and cancellation policies.
- Provide clear updates to operations and leadership regarding booking status.
- Serve as a central coordination point across travel, media, marketing, and admin teams.
- Ensure alignment between travel activity and content creation.
- Track tasks and deliverables across teams and follow up to completion.
- Support smooth communication and execution across brands.
- Create and maintain worklists, trackers, and timelines using Google Workspace.
- Use Google Sheets to track bookings, content, and operational tasks.
- Maintain organized documentation and shared drives.
- Support improvements to workflows and operational systems.
- Communicate professionally with U.S.-based clients via email, phone, and digital platforms.
- Maintain strong responsiveness aligned with U.S. time zones.
- Provide clear, structured travel documentation and confirmations.
- Handle client questions, changes, and concerns with professionalism.
- Uphold high customer service standards expected in the U.S. travel market.
- Support booking processes as Innovasol expands into the Nigerian and regional travel market.
- Adapt communication and service approaches for different client segments.
- Identify opportunities to improve travel workflows for local and international clients.
Qualifications
- Minimum 4+ years of professional travel agency experience.
- Availability to work weekdays and weekends as needed based on trips and launches, and client intake needs etc.
- Proven experience managing group travel and complex bookings.
- Strong understanding of travel documentation, reservations systems, and supplier coordination.
- Experience serving U.S.-based clients preferred.
- Strong project management and coordination skills.
- High proficiency in Google Workspace, especially Google Sheets.
- Ability to manage multiple projects, brands, and timelines.
- Strong knowledge of analytics and reporting, with the ability to translate data into strategy.
- Excellent leadership, copywriting, follow-up skills and communication skills.
- Highly organized, detail-oriented, and capable of managing multiple campaigns simultaneously.
